Transaction 33bfd95341742c50bc975df2a36a082b95e02378a94067a5c89f02c6340ab884
1 Input
1 Output
-
33bfd95341742c50bc975df2a36a082b95e02378a94067a5c89f02c6340ab884:0
- value
- 10011198
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c2ccc0f3e61bf0ccf0b5da6ff424541762031cc
- address
- bc1qmskvcre7vxlsencttkn07sj9g9mzqvwv0x3pnh